IPC분류정보
국가/구분 |
United States(US) Patent
등록
|
국제특허분류(IPC7판) |
|
출원번호 |
US-0338079
(2011-12-27)
|
등록번호 |
US-8640179
(2014-01-28)
|
발명자
/ 주소 |
|
출원인 / 주소 |
- Network-1 Security Solutions, Inc.
|
대리인 / 주소 |
Amster, Rothstein & Ebenstein LLP
|
인용정보 |
피인용 횟수 :
7 인용 특허 :
200 |
초록
▼
A computer-implemented method including the steps of maintaining, by a computer system including at least one computer, a database in which is stored first data related to identification of one or more works and second data related to information corresponding to each of the one or more works as ide
A computer-implemented method including the steps of maintaining, by a computer system including at least one computer, a database in which is stored first data related to identification of one or more works and second data related to information corresponding to each of the one or more works as identified by the first data. Extracted features of a work to be identified are obtained. The work is identified by comparing the extracted features of the work with the first data in the database using a non-exhaustive neighbor search. The information corresponding to the identified work is determined based on the second data in the database. The determined information is associated with the identified work.
대표청구항
▼
1. A computer-implemented method comprising: (a) maintaining, by a computer system including at least one computer, a database comprising: (1) first electronic data related to identification of one or more reference electronic works; and(2) second electronic data related to action information compri
1. A computer-implemented method comprising: (a) maintaining, by a computer system including at least one computer, a database comprising: (1) first electronic data related to identification of one or more reference electronic works; and(2) second electronic data related to action information comprising an action to perform corresponding to each of the one or more reference electronic works;(b) obtaining, by the computer system, extracted features of a first electronic work;(c) identifying, by the computer system, the first electronic work by comparing the extracted features of the first electronic work with the first electronic data in the database using a non-exhaustive neighbor search;(d) determining, by the computer system, the action information corresponding to the identified first electronic work based on the second electronic data in the database; and(e) associating, by the computer system, the determined action information with the identified first electronic work. 2. The computer-implemented method of claim 1, wherein the step of obtaining comprises receiving the first electronic work and extracting the extracted features from the first electronic work. 3. The computer-implemented method of claim 2, wherein the first electronic work is received from at least one of a set-top-box, a video recorder, a cell phone, a computer, or a portable device. 4. The computer-implemented method of claim 1, wherein the step of obtaining comprises receiving the extracted features. 5. The computer-implemented method of claim 4, wherein the extracted features are received from at least one of a set-top-box, a video recorder, a cell phone, a computer, or a portable device. 6. The computer-implemented method of claim 1, wherein the step of obtaining comprises receiving the first electronic work and the extracted features of the first electronic work. 7. The computer-implemented method of claim 6, wherein the first electronic work and the extracted features of the first electronic work are received from at least one of a set-top-box, a video recorder, a cell phone, a computer, or a portable device. 8. The computer-implemented method of claim 1, wherein at least one of the first electronic work or the extracted features of the first electronic work is obtained from at least one of a set-top-box, a video recorder, a cell phone, a computer, or a portable device that stores commercial transaction data, and wherein the action information comprises a commercial transaction, and the method further comprises: electronically performing the commercial transaction using the stored commercial transaction data. 9. The computer-implemented method of claim 1, wherein at least one of the first electronic work or the extracted features of the first electronic work is obtained from at least one of a set-top-box, a video recorder, a cell phone, a computer, or a portable device, and wherein the action information comprises commercial transaction data, and the method further comprises: electronically performing the commercial transaction through the at least one of a set-top-box, a video recorder, a cell phone, a computer, or a portable device using the commercial transaction data. 10. The computer-implemented method of claim 8, wherein the stored commercial transaction data comprises at least one of a purchaser's name, a purchaser's address, or credit card information. 11. The computer-implemented method of claim 1, wherein the action comprises at least one of directing a user to a website related to the first electronic work, initiating an e-commerce transaction, or dialing a phone number. 12. The computer-implemented method of claim 1, wherein the action comprises providing and/or displaying additional information in association with the first electronic work. 13. A computer-implemented method comprising: (a) maintaining, by a computer system, one or more databases comprising: (1) first electronic data comprising a first digitally created compact electronic representation of one or more reference electronic works; and(2) second electronic data related to an action, the action comprising providing and/or displaying an advertisement corresponding to each of the one or more reference electronic works;(b) obtaining, by the computer system, a second digitally created compact electronic representation of a first electronic work;(c) identifying, by the computer system, a matching reference electronic work that matches the first electronic work by comparing the first electronic data with the second digitally created compact electronic representation using a non-exhaustive neighbor search;(d) determining, by the computer system, the action corresponding to the matching reference electronic work based on the second electronic data in the database; and(e) associating, by the computer system, the determined action with the first electronic work. 14. The computer-implemented method of claim 13, wherein the action further comprises providing a link to a site on the World Wide Web associated with the advertisement. 15. The computer-implemented method of claim 13, wherein the action further comprises electronically registering a user with at least one of a service or a product related to the advertisement. 16. The computer-implemented method of claim 13, wherein the action further comprises electronically providing at least one of a coupon or a certificate related to the advertisement. 17. The computer-implemented method of claim 13, wherein the action further comprises automatically dialing a telephone number associated with the advertisement. 18. The computer-implemented method of claim 13, wherein the action further comprises collecting competitive market research data related to the advertisement. 19. The computer-implemented method of claim 13, wherein the action further comprises purchasing a product or service related to the advertisement. 20. The computer-implemented method of claim 13, wherein the action further comprises allowing a user to interact with a broadcast related to the advertisement. 21. The computer-implemented method of claim 1, further comprising the step of transmitting, by the computer system, the determined action as associated with the first electronic work. 22. The computer-implemented method of claim 1, wherein the one or more electronic works comprise at least one of a video work, an audio work, or an image work. 23. The computer-implemented method of claim 1, wherein the method further comprises the additional steps of: (f) obtaining, by the computer system, second extracted features of a second electronic work;(g) searching, by the computer system, for an identification of the second electronic work by comparing the second extracted features of the second electronic work with the first electronic data in the database using a non-exhaustive neighbor search; and(h) determining, by the computer system, that the second electronic work is not identified based on results of the searching step. 24. The computer-implemented method of claim 13, wherein the method further comprises the additional steps of: (f) obtaining, by the computer system, second extracted features of a second electronic work to be identified;(g) searching, by the computer system, for an identification of the second electronic work by comparing the second extracted features of the second electronic work with the first electronic data in the database using a non-exhaustive neighbor search; and(h) determining, by the computer system, that the second electronic work is not identified based on results of the searching step. 25. A computer-implemented method comprising the steps of: (a) maintaining, by a computer system, one or more databases comprising: (1) first electronic data comprising a first digitally created compact electronic representation comprising an extracted feature vector of one or more reference electronic works; and(2) second electronic data related to action information, the action information comprising an action to perform corresponding to each of the one or more reference electronic works;(b) obtaining, by the computer system, a second digitally created compact electronic representation comprising an extracted feature vector of a first electronic work;(c) identifying, by the computer system, a matching reference electronic work that matches the first electronic work by comparing the first electronic data with the second digitally created compact electronic representation of the first electronic work using a non-exhaustive neighbor search;(d) determining, by the computer system, the action information corresponding to the matching reference electronic work based on the second electronic data in the database; and(e) associating, by the computer system, the determined action information with the first electronic work. 26. The computer-implemented method of claim 25, wherein the one or more computer readable media have stored thereon further computer instructions for carrying out the additional steps of: (f) obtaining, by the computer system, a third digitally created compact electronic representation comprising an extracted feature vector of a second electronic work;(g) searching, by the computer system, for a matching reference electronic work that matches the second electronic work by comparing the third digitally created compact electronic representation of the second electronic work with the first electronic data in the database using a non-exhaustive neighbor search; and(h) determining, by the computer system, that a matching reference electronic work that matches the second electronic work does not exist based on results of the searching step. 27. The method of claim 13, wherein the extracted feature is extracted using frequency based decomposition. 28. The computer-implemented method of claim 13, wherein the extracted feature is extracted using principal component analysis. 29. The computer-implemented method of claim 13, wherein the extracted feature is extracted using temporal sequence of feature vectors. 30. The computer-implemented method of claim 13, wherein the first electronic work is obtained from a first user device that is at least one of a set-top-box, a video recorder, a cell phone, a computer, or a portable device, and wherein the action information comprises a commercial transaction, and the method further comprises: electronically performing the commercial transaction using commercial transaction data obtained using the first user device. 31. The computer-implemented method of claim 30, wherein the commercial transaction data comprises at least one of a purchaser's name, a purchaser's address, or credit card information. 32. The computer-implemented method of claim 13, wherein the extracted features of the first electronic work are obtained from a first user device that is at least one of a set-top-box, a video recorder, a cell phone, a computer, or a portable device that stores commercial transaction data, and wherein the action information comprises a commercial transaction, and the method further comprises: electronically performing the commercial transaction using commercial transaction data obtained using the first user device. 33. The computer-implemented method of claim 32, wherein the commercial transaction data comprises at least one of a purchaser's name, a purchaser's address, or credit card information. 34. The computer-implemented method of claim 13, further comprising the step of transmitting, by the computer system, the determined action information as associated with the first electronic identified work. 35. The computer-implemented method of claim 13, wherein the one or more electronic works comprise at least one of a video work, an audio work, or an image work. 36. The computer-implemented method of claim 25, further comprising the step of transmitting, by the computer system, the determined action information as associated with the first electronic identified work. 37. The computer-implemented method of claim 35, wherein the one or more electronic works comprise at least one of a video work, an audio work, or an image work.
※ AI-Helper는 부적절한 답변을 할 수 있습니다.